    The New York Knicks defeated the Indiana Pacers, 121-117. Jalen Brunson recorded his 4th straight game of 40+ points as he went for 43 points, 6 rebounds, and 6 assists for the Knicks, with Donte DiVincenzo (25 points) and Josh Hart (24 points, 13 rebounds, and 8 assists) combining for 49 points in the victory. Myles Turner tallied 23 points and 3 assists for the Pacers in the losing effort. The Knicks lead the best-of-seven series 1-0, with Game 2 taking place on Wednesday May 8, 8:00 PM ET, on TNT/truTV.
    Jalen Brunson joins Patrick Ewing and Walt Frazier as the only players in Knicks playoff franchise history to record multiple playoff games of 35+ points, 5+ rebounds, and 5+ assists
    Jalen Brunson becomes the 4th player in NBA playoff history to record 40+ points in 4+ playoff games, joining:
    Jerry West (6x) 1965
    Michael Jordan (4x) 1993
    Bernard King (4x) 1984
    Jalen Brunson becomes the first player in NBA history to record 40+ points and 5+ assists in 4 straight playoff games
    Jalen Brunson (210 points, 47 assists) is the first player in NBA Playoff history to record 200+ points and 45+ assists over a 5-game span
